Media trials, Mahatma Gandhi and law

The Bombay High Court issued notices to lawyers regarding their conduct, not as citizens but as advocates and pleaders. The court observed that it had “nothing to do with their political views” nor “with expressions of opinion on their part, however strong, against any particular measure proposed by the legislature”.
